American Sign Language: "don't need". Suppose you wanted to sign, "don't need." You don't need a separate sign for "don't." Instead you can just shake your head negatively while signing NEED. Learn how to sign “Need” in American Sign Language(ASL). 1. Starts as a straight index finger that turns into an "X" but the thumb is out as it moves toward the person being asked. 2. bends at the wrist up and down for twice. This phrase often implies the speaker's willingness to help or provide for the listener.In Deaf Culture, lighting is important as well. You will notice that the most common place for Deaf people to converse in a house is the kitchen. This is because the lighting in a kitchen is normally the best in the house. Jul 24, 2023 · Sign language is a form of communication that relies on manual and nonmanual features rather than spoken words. In addition to hand gestures, sign language can use facial expressions and body language. Specifically, eye and mouth movements help convey adjectives and adverbs.
